The breakers will help protect the electrical equipment from damage caused by current surges, which is hoped will improve the reliability of the network.
“We are proud to support Eskom in this critical period of strengthening the power grid,” comments Bernhard Jucker, head of ABB’s oower products division.
“Our production capabilities, together with the expertise of the local teams that will install and commission the equipment, helped us secure what is one of ABB’s largest-ever orders for circuit breakers.”
ABB will deliver about 2,000 circuit breakers with operating voltages of 66kV and 132kV over a five-year period, and will take responsibility for their installation and commissioning.
